Madrid's Highlights

Madrid, Spain's capital, is full of cultural heritage and lively experiences. Don't miss the Royal Palace, Prado Museum, Retiro Park, and Gran Vía.

Barcelona’s Wonders

Barcelona dazzles with Gaudí’s Sagrada Familia, the colorful Park Güell, the historic Gothic Quarter, and the bustling La Rambla. It’s a city of unique architecture and vibrant life.

Seville's Charm

Seville is known for its flamenco, historic sites like the Seville Cathedral and Alcázar, and the picturesque Plaza de España. Don’t miss the Triana District’s vibrant nightlife.

Valencia’s Beauty

Valencia blends modernity with history. Visit the futuristic City of Arts and Sciences, relax at Malvarrosa Beach, explore the Gothic Valencia Cathedral, and enjoy Turia Gardens.

Granada’s Majesty

Granada is famous for the Alhambra palace, Generalife Gardens, and the Albaicín Arab quarter. The Renaissance Granada Cathedral is also a highlight.

Canary Islands Escape

The Canary Islands offer diverse landscapes and mild climate. Explore Tenerife’s Mount Teide, Gran Canaria’s varied terrain, Lanzarote’s volcanic landscapes, and Fuerteventura’s beaches.

Travel Tips

  • Plan Your Itinerary: Mix cultural, historical, and natural attractions.
  • Understand Local Customs: Respect local traditions and sites.
  • Learn Basic Spanish Phrases: Help with navigation and communication.
  • Stay Connected: Get a local SIM card or portable Wi-Fi.
  • Use Public Transport: Convenient and cost-effective travel.
